CEFER:一个基于上下文和情感嵌入特征的四个方面框架,用于隐式和明确的情感识别

CEFER: A Four Facets Framework based on Context and Emotion embedded features for Implicit and Explicit Emotion Recognition

论文作者

Khoshnam, Fereshteh, Baraani-Dastjerdi, Ahmad, Liaghatdar, M. J.

论文摘要

人们的行为和反应是由他们的情绪驱动的。在线社交媒体正在成为以书面形式表达情感的好工具。注意上下文和整个句子,帮助我们从文本中检测到情感。但是,这种观点抑制了我们注意文本中的一些情感单词或短语,尤其是当单词隐含地而不是明确地表达情感时。另一方面,仅关注单词并忽略上下文会导致对句子含义和感觉的理解。在本文中,我们提出了一个框架,以分析句子和单词级别的文本。我们将其命名为CEFER(情感识别的上下文和情感嵌入式框架)。我们的四个方法是通过同时考虑整个句子和每个单词以及隐式和明确的情绪来提取数据。从这些数据中获得的知识不仅减轻了前面方法中缺陷的影响,还可以增强特征向量。我们使用BERT家族评估几个特征空间,并根据其设计CEFER。 CEFER将每个单词的情感向量结合在一起,包括明确和隐性情绪,以及基于上下文的每个单词的特征向量。 CEFER的表现比Bert家族更好。实验结果表明,识别隐性情绪比检测明确的情绪更具挑战性。 CEFER,提高了隐性情感识别的准确性。根据结果​​,CEFER在识别明确的情绪和隐性中的3%方面的表现要比BERT家族好5%。

People's conduct and reactions are driven by their emotions. Online social media is becoming a great instrument for expressing emotions in written form. Paying attention to the context and the entire sentence help us to detect emotion from texts. However, this perspective inhibits us from noticing some emotional words or phrases in the text, particularly when the words express an emotion implicitly rather than explicitly. On the other hand, focusing only on the words and ignoring the context results in a distorted understanding of the sentence meaning and feeling. In this paper, we propose a framework that analyses text at both the sentence and word levels. We name it CEFER (Context and Emotion embedded Framework for Emotion Recognition). Our four approach facets are to extracting data by considering the entire sentence and each individual word simultaneously, as well as implicit and explicit emotions. The knowledge gained from these data not only mitigates the impact of flaws in the preceding approaches but also it strengthens the feature vector. We evaluate several feature spaces using BERT family and design the CEFER based on them. CEFER combines the emotional vector of each word, including explicit and implicit emotions, with the feature vector of each word based on context. CEFER performs better than the BERT family. The experimental results demonstrate that identifying implicit emotions are more challenging than detecting explicit emotions. CEFER, improves the accuracy of implicit emotion recognition. According to the results, CEFER perform 5% better than the BERT family in recognizing explicit emotions and 3% in implicit.
